What Kinesio Tape Actually Does — The Mechanism

Kinesio tape is an elastic therapeutic tape applied to the skin with specific tension and direction. It works through two primary mechanisms — and understanding both is what separates clinical application from the tape you see athletes wearing without much thought to placement.

The first mechanism is decompression. The tape's elastic recoil gently lifts the skin away from the underlying tissue, reducing pressure on pain receptors in the superficial layer and creating space for improved lymphatic drainage and circulation. This is why it's effective for swelling management and acute soft tissue soreness.

The second mechanism is proprioception. The continuous skin contact provides the nervous system with ongoing sensory input about the taped area's position and movement — improving muscle activation, joint awareness, and movement control in ways that persist for as long as the tape is worn.

.💡 What Kinesio Tape Can and Can't Do

It can: Reduce swelling after acute injury or soft tissue treatment, provide proprioceptive feedback that improves muscle activation and posture, offer joint support without restricting movement, and extend the effects of treatment between visits.

It can't: Break up adhesions, restore joint motion, fix structural movement dysfunction, or replace ART, IASTM, or chiropractic adjustments. We use it where it genuinely adds value — and we'll always tell you when something more structural is what you actually need.

Common Uses at Our Office

  • Post-treatment swelling reduction after ART or IASTM

  • Shoulder support during return to pressing or overhead work

  • Knee support for runners during return-to-training phase

  • Ankle stability support after sprain rehabilitation

  • Postural facilitation for rounded shoulder correction

  • Plantar fascia support between visits for persistent foot pain

  • Lower back facilitation for patients relearning neutral posture

How We Apply Kinesio Tape — Four Clinical Uses

Application direction, tension, and pattern all change the effect. Here's how we use it at Renewed Body:

Lymphatic / Swelling Reduction

Fan-shaped application with minimal tension over a swollen area — lifts the skin to improve lymphatic drainage and reduce fluid accumulation after injury or intensive soft tissue work.

Joint Support

Applied around a joint with more tension to provide mechanical support without full restriction — useful for recovering ankles, knees, and shoulders that need reinforcement during activity.

Proprioceptive / Postural Feedback

Applied along a muscle or joint with specific tension to provide continuous sensory input — improving muscle activation patterns and postural awareness during long workdays or athletic training.

Muscle Facilitation or Inhibition

Applied with tension in the direction of muscle contraction to facilitate an underactive muscle, or against contraction direction to reduce tone in an overactive one — used to complement corrective exercise.
